Product Description
Digital rectal examination (DRE) is the most necessary and simple examination method for benign prostatic hyperplasia (BPH) and rectal tumors
1. Prostate palpation
1) Normal prostate: Simulated chestnut size, with a transverse diameter of 4cm, a vertical diameter of 3cm, and a anterior and posterior diameter of 2cm. There is a longitudinal shallow groove in the middle behind the prostate gland, known as the prostatic sulcus.
2) Benign prostatic hyperplasia: First degree hyperplasia of the prostate, enlargement of the prostate, simulating the size of an egg, flat at the back of the prostate, and middle sulcus shallows.
3) Benign prostatic hyperplasia: Second degree hyperplasia of the prostate, moderate enlargement of the prostate, simulating the size of a duck egg, and middle sulcus disappears.
4) Benign prostatic hyperplasia: Third degree hyperplasia of the prostate, severe enlargement of the prostate, regular surface, hard texture, simulating the size of a goose egg, and the bottom of the prostate cannot be touched.
2. Rectal palpation
1) Normal rectum.
2) Rectal polyp: A nodular mass can be palpable on the surface of the posterior wall of the rectum, with a relatively hard texture.
3) Early stage of rectal cancer: Nodules and lumps can be palpable on the surface of the posterior wall of the rectum, with uneven surfaces. The texture is hard and represents the late stage of development of rectal cancer.
